The bug reported here is already fixed in the version for which the bug
was reported.

This bug was present in the previous version. The current version was
uploaded precisely to fix the problem reported.

Previous version (5.1-2) had

Depends: libglobus-common0 (>= 15)

Current version (5.1-3) has

Depends: libglobus-common0 (>= 15) | libglobus-common0t64 (>= 15)

I.e. it does not depend only on the old package name, but on either the
new or the old. The package is therefore not blocking the t64
transition.
